Modchips have been both popular and cheap, but the installation requirements can be a big barrier to entry. Recently, there was a save game exploit known as TonyHax, that would utilize the Tony Hawk Pro Skater games. Which with a low barrier, is still a barrier. But now, we don't even need a disc to softmod our PSX. You just need a spare memory card and a way to put software on the memory card.
This video is going to be a tutorial of me showing you how to do just that, putting software on a memory card.
